Artificial intelligence and extreme personalization
Advanced AI integration is transforming WhatsApp marketing from basic automated communication to truly intelligent conversations that rival human interactions in sophistication and personalization.
Evolutionary natural language processing
Advances in NLP are enabling systems to understand not only the words but the context, tone, intent, and emotions behind messages. This enables more appropriate responses and perfect timing for different types of communication.

Predictive customization
Predictive AI is evolving to anticipate customer needs before they explicitly express them. This enables proactive communication that delivers value at the perfect time, significantly increasing marketing effectiveness.
Future systems will analyze behavioral patterns, buying cycles, and external signals to predict when a customer will be most receptive to different types of offers or content, optimizing timing to maximize conversions.
Personalization will extend beyond content to the entire experience: individually optimized communication schedules, preferred content formats, and scaling channels based on each user's historical preferences.
Intelligent automation with emotional context
The next generation of automation will incorporate emotional intelligence, recognizing emotional states of users and adapting communication accordingly. This is especially important in WhatsApp where expectations for empathy and understanding are high.
The systems will be able to identify when a user is frustrated, excited, confused, or urgent, and automatically adjust the communication approach to be more appropriate for the identified emotional state.
This ability will be crucial to maintain positive relationships and avoid inappropriate communication that could damage brand perception or result in customer churn.

Augmented reality and immersive experiences
WhatsApp is expanding multimedia capabilities to include AR experiences that will enable product demonstrations, virtual tours, and interactive experiences directly within conversations.
These capabilities will especially transform the marketing of physical products, allowing customers to "try" products virtually before they buy, reducing friction and increasing confidence in purchasing decisions.

Evolution of conversational commerce
WhatsApp is evolving into a full commerce platform where conversations are seamlessly integrated with transactions, creating more natural and effective shopping experiences.
Integrated payments and conversational checkout
The integration of payment systems directly into WhatsApp will eliminate friction in the purchase process, allowing complete transactions without leaving the conversation.
Conversational checkout will allow customers to ask questions, receive personalized recommendations, and complete purchases in a natural flow that feels more like personal consulting than a digital transaction.

Adaptation to regulations and privacy
The future of WhatsApp marketing will be significantly influenced by evolving privacy regulations and increasing expectations of transparency and user control.
Granular consent and transparency
Future regulations will require more specific and granular consent for different types of marketing communications, forcing companies to be more transparent about how they use data and what types of messages they will send.
This will create opportunities for companies that implement superior privacy practices, differentiating themselves through transparency and respect for user preferences.

Value-based marketing vs. intrusion
Privacy restrictions will push marketing toward value-based models where users actively opt-in to receive communication because it provides genuine benefit.
This shift will favor companies that already prioritize value over volume, creating competitive advantages for those that have invested in quality content and genuine personalization.
Future WhatsApp marketing will be less about reaching mass audiences and more about building deep relationships with specific audiences who genuinely value communication.
Privacy-preserving technologies
New technologies will enable advanced personalization while preserving user privacy, using techniques such as federated learning and differential privacy for insights without compromising individual data.
These technologies will allow companies to maintain personalization capabilities while complying with strict privacy regulations, creating the best of both worlds for companies and users.
